Output 103bc60d7a68a0093712046fdac9d20240d04be7a23948bcee5aab308e82bf12:4
- value
- 37354423
- script pubkey
- OP_0 OP_PUSHBYTES_20 0dc63d1e0a2e071fea1f05b5dadd22e2a364ff6a
- address
- tb1qphrr68s29cr3l6slqk6a4hfzu23kflm22v8a7p
- transaction
- 103bc60d7a68a0093712046fdac9d20240d04be7a23948bcee5aab308e82bf12